Verdict

Inglewood, CA offers better overall compensation for dietitians and nutritionists, winning 3 out of 4 metrics compared to Los Angeles.

The salary gap between Inglewood and Los Angeles is $4,544 (4.58%). Inglewood's median is +30.66% compared to the US national median of $79,380.

Salary Range Comparison

The full salary range (10th to 90th percentile) in Inglewood spans $85,313,Los Angeles spans $44,334. Inglewood has a wider pay range, meaning more potential for high earners but also more variation.

Cost-of-Living Adjusted Comparison

After cost-of-living adjustment, Inglewood ($91,704 effective) pays 5.01% more than Los Angeles ($87,326 effective).

Methodology & Data Source

All salary figures are 2026 projections based on BLS OEWS May 2025 data. A 3.90% CAGR (derived from 6-year national BLS trends) was applied to estimate current compensation. Cost-of-living adjustments use BEA Regional Price Parity data. Actual salaries vary by employer, certifications, and experience.
